Got a phone call monday night, its the guy from the scrap yard. "Got another twin here for ya". I thought it was a bit strange as he usualy keeps and finds nothing for me.

Id sooner a half decent late model but i wont say no. The other one ive got needs parts anyway. Muffler in particular. I think the paint on this one is actually better. The back axle needs a bit of work and one end of the spreader bar is broken.
[Linked Image]
[Linked Image]

Also grabbed a Husqvarna mulcher. This might get put aside with the Solo untill i have a booth to blast them in so they can be repainted.
[Linked Image]
Early model Colt 5. Should be able to make one up out of the two. Have a colt 8 here with a stuffed rear axle and sad deck.
[Linked Image]
Two store brand Victas. One id put up here previous and the low arch. The high arch, the base is mint, the low arch is good too, axles are a bit sloppy but thats probably the clips. If you want them put aside speak up, or they will be fixed and sold.
